How to Wash a Cashmere Sweater

Cashmere is a delicate fiber that requires special care to maintain its softness and shape. Here are the steps on how to wash a cashmere sweater:

1. Check the Care Label: Before washing, always check the care label on the sweater for specific instructions. Some cashmere sweaters may require dry cleaning only.

2. Hand Wash: The safest way to wash a cashmere sweater is by hand. Fill a clean sink or basin with cool water (around 30 degrees Celsius or 86 degrees Fahrenheit). Use a gentle laundry detergent specifically designed for delicate fabrics or cashmere.

3. Submerge the Sweater: Gently submerge the cashmere sweater in the water. Make sure the entire sweater is soaked.

4. Agitate Gently: Lightly agitate the sweater by gently squeezing and releasing it in the water. Avoid any rough scrubbing or wringing, which can damage the fibers.

5. Rinse Thoroughly: Rinse the sweater thoroughly with cool water until all the detergent has been removed.

6. Blot Dry: Place the cashmere sweater on a clean towel. Gently press the towel against the sweater to absorb excess water. Avoid twisting or wringing the sweater.

7. Lay Flat to Dry: Lay the cashmere sweater flat on a drying rack or a clean towel to dry. Do not hang the sweater as it can stretch out of shape.

8. Reshape: While the sweater is still slightly damp, gently reshape it by smoothing out any wrinkles or bulges.

9. Dry Completely: Allow the cashmere sweater to dry completely before storing or wearing it.

Remember: Cashmere is a luxurious fabric that requires proper care. If you're unsure about washing your cashmere sweater, consider taking it to a professional dry cleaner.
